MARINE DEPARTMENT.

The Marine snd Inspection of Machinery Department, in conjunction with the Government steamers Hinemoa and Tutanekai, and the training ship Amokura, held its annual picnic at Day's Bay last week. The weather was ideal, and a most enjoyable day was spent by all. The party travelled to and from the Bay in the Terawhiti, kindly lent by the Union Steam Ship Company, Ltd. There was no lack of competition in connection with the lengthy sports programme, the results of which are given below. The thanks of the committee aTe due to all who contributed to the prize fund. In addition to the official programme, some further events were arranged for the Amokura boys, and much amusement Was afforded by the "frog" and "wheelbarrow" races. Results :—
